Линейная алгоритмическая структура 


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Линейная алгоритмическая структура



Существуют задачи, в которых требуется организовать выбор выполнения последовательности действий в зависимости от каких-либо условий. Такие алгоритмы называются алгоритмами разветвляющейся структуры.

Разветвляющиеся алгоритмическиеструктуры

Алгоритмическая структура «Множественный выбор»

 

 

Циклический алгоритм

Алгоритмы, отдельные действия в которых многократно повторяются, называются алгоритмами циклической структуры. Совокупность повторяющихся действий принято называть циклом. При разработке циклического алгоритма вводят следующие понятия: параметр цикла – величина, с изменением которой связано многократное выполнение цикла; начальное и конечное значение параметров цикла; шаг цикла – значение, на которое изменяется параметр цикла при каждом повторении.

Цикл организуется по определенным правилам. Циклический алгоритм состоит из подготовки цикла, тела цикла, условия продолжения цикла.

В подготовку цикла входят действия, связанные с заданием исходных данных для параметров цикла и других величин, использующихся в цикле.

В тело цикла входят: многократно повторяющиеся действия для вычисления искомых величин; подготовка следующего значения параметра цикла; подготовка других значений, необходимых для повторного выполнения действий в теле цикла. Если параметр цикла превысил конечное значение, то выполнение цикла должно быть прекращено.

Циклические алгоритмические структуры

Алгоритмическая структура «Цикл» обеспечивает многократное выполнениенекоторой последовательности действий, которая называется телом цикла. Иногда внутри тела цикла бывает необходимо организовать внутренний цикл.Такая структура называется вложенные циклы.

 

Цикл с параметром

 

Циклы с условием

 

Пример использования алгоритмической структуры «Цикл»
в задаче расчета значений функции по формуле у = (а + b)²
при значениях, а из интервала [-5, 5] с шагом +1.

 

Вопросы для контроля

1. Что такое алгоритм?

2. Перечислите основные свойства алгоритмов?

3. Какие существуют способы описания алгоритмов?

4. Назовите основные этапы решения задач на компьютере.

 

Глава 5

Информационные технологии

Информационные технологии

Все информационные технологии, то есть последовательные шаги по преобразованию информации, содержат в разном сочетании следующие этапы:

· сбор информации;

· хранение информации;

· передача информации;

· обработка информации.

Учитывая это, можно дать следующее определение понятию информационной технологии.

Информационная технология – это система научных и инженерных знаний, а также методов и средств, которые используются для создания, сбора, передачи, хранения и обработки информации в конкретной предметной области.

Информационный технологический процесс делится на части– операции. Под операцией понимается часть технологического процесса, выполняемую одним исполнителем на одном рабочем месте. Признаком законченной операции является передача носителя информации после соответствующей обработки с одного рабочего места на другое.

В зависимости от используемых технических средств операции можно разделить на ручные, автоматизированные автоматические.

Этапы информационных технологий. На различных стадиях технического прогресса этапы сбора, хранения, передачи и обработки информации реализовывался с помощью различных технических средств. В настоящее время каждый год приносит все новые и новые разработки в этой области, что кардинальным образом изменяет информационные технологии.

 



Поделиться:


Последнее изменение этой страницы: 2017-01-19; просмотров: 425;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.142.171.180 (0.007 с.)